Description

This episode of the series “Louisiana Public Square” from July 25, 2018, features Andre Moreau leading a discussion between the audience members and panelists on preventing suicide. A background report on the topic precedes the discussion. It includes interviews with: Emma Benoit, suicide survivor; Barney LeJeune, the executive director of the Jacob Crouch Suicide Prevention Services in Lafayette; Dr. Frank Campbell, a suicidologist; and Dr. April Foreman, a licensed psychologist at the Southeast Louisiana Veterans Healthcare System. The audience members then share their stories of how they have been impacted by suicide. A panel of experts then joins the audience to answer their questions. The panelists are: Danita LeBlanc, the suicide prevention coordinator with the Louisiana Department of Health; Dr. Raymond Tucker, the founder of the LSU Mitigation of Suicidal Behavior Research Laboratory; Tonja Miles, a suicide survivor and recovery advocate; and Cynthia Elmer, the board chair of the American Foundation for Suicide Prevention in Louisiana. They discuss: the biggest misconceptions about suicide; the warning signs; the importance of overcoming the stigma of suicide; how to help someone who is exhibiting suicidal behavior; the training received by school personnel; online resources; the risk factors; and the connection between firearms and suicide.
